		<description>REGARDING:
&quot;Since July 1st, 16% of Baptist’s COVID hospitalizations have been fully vaccinated patients. What?!? 16% breakthrough cases in the hospital in our area doesn’t seem “rare.”&quot;

15.5%, but close enough

20 out of 129 hospitalized  did not REPORT they had not been fully vaccinated.
Assume they were, though.
The CDC reported 6,587 COVID-19 breakthrough cases of the fully vaccinated as of July 26, with 6,239 hospitalizations &amp; 1,263 deaths among the more than 163 million people in the United States who were fully vaccinated against COVID-19.

This means less than 0.004% of fully vaccinated people had a breakthrough case that led to hospitalization and less than 0.001% of fully vaccinated people died from a breakthrough Covid-19 case. 

Which is to say: 
ONE out of every 129,057 vaccinated people died anyway (because it failed them and those around them insisted on infecting them).
In contrast, 36,240 infections in this county have resulted in 706 deaths or more than ONE out of every 52 infections have led to deaths in this county.

An interesting gamble to make.</description>
